    Cyberquad aint just for kids, used as an EV camera rig at TeslaTakeover

    This weekend is the 2023 Tesla Takeover event held in the fields at Madonna Inn, San Luis Obispo, California. The 2-day event is a great opportunity for Tesla owners to connect with other Tesla enthusiasts, learn about the latest advancements in electric vehicle technology, and celebrate the future of sustainable transportation.

    Those attending have started sharing pictures and videos from the event and one post in particular stood out. This post from CEO Knightscope, William Santana Li shows a film crew using the all-electric Cyberquad for Kids, being used in a very different way.

    A film crew has attached a massive camera stabilizer on the front of it. Given the location is on grass, this presents a unique challenge for creating smooth video, but from the video, it looks like this rig works well to keep the camera steady.

    Being attached to a small, nimble quad allows the camera to access areas larger rigs (often mounted to cars) would not be able to achieve. While we wait for an adult-sized cyberquad, this kids version allows the camera to maneuver over rough terrain, while having zero emissions and being virtually silent.

    The crew are capturing the Robot Roadshow pod which showcases products from Knightscope. The pod itself looks impressive, with large glass windows and is able to expand to almost 3x the size of a standard container, making the space feel open and inviting. The pod is transported between events on a truck, and is scheduled to travel from CA to OH, PA and IL in the next 2 months.

    The first Tesla Takeover was held in 2016 and has since grown to become the largest in-person community event in California, and one of the largest in North America. The weekend will be highlighted by keynote presenter Maye Musk, world-renowned dietician, model, entrepreneur, and bestselling author, and Sandy Munro, CEO of Munro Associates.

    The event includes a wide range of activities including:

    • Meet and greet with your favourite Tesla YouTubers and influencers
    • Test drive Arcimoto’s all-electric fun utility vehicles (FUVs)
    • Educational workshops and seminars
    • Showcase and contest for the best customized Teslas
    • Assembly of rare and original Tesla Roadsters
    • Exhibitor expo of unique Tesla accessories, services, and products
    • Meet up with your local Tesla owners club
    • Activities for the kids include a Tesla coloring contest, bounce house, obstacle course, and Cyberquad rides
    • Entertainment including DJ, food trucks, and much more
    • Saturday and Sunday, 10 am to 4pm
